Specs at a Glance
- Padding: Dual-layer high-density foam + gel insert
- Shell material: Waterproof, UV-resistant nylon
- Fit: Universal — compatible with most sit-in and sit-on-top kayaks
- Attachment: Four adjustable quick-release strap system
- Back support height: ~17 inches
- Weight: Approx. 1.8 lbs
- Colors available: Black, Blue, Gray, Orange
What We Like
- Gel padding actually works. The dual-layer foam-plus-gel construction distributes pressure far better than foam alone. Multi-hour sessions on the water become noticeably more comfortable.
- Easy install. The four-strap system clips onto almost any kayak seat rail or D-ring in minutes. No tools, no drilling.
- Built to get wet. The waterproof nylon shell dries quickly and the UV resistance means it won’t fade or crack after a summer on the water.
- Adjustable back angle. Side straps let you dial in lumbar support angle, which matters a lot on longer paddles.
- Great value. At its price point, the WOOWAVE competes with seats costing twice as much.
What Could Be Better
- Thin-rail kayaks may need adapter straps. A small minority of kayak designs have unusually narrow rails — double-check your kayak’s seat rail width before ordering.
- Back pocket is small. The storage pocket on the back is handy but only fits slim items like energy bars or a folded map.
- Not ideal for pedal-drive kayaks. If you’re in a Hobie or similar pedal drive system, the seat geometry may not play as nicely — check your model first.
